Remarks & Notes |
Mount Nebo at 11,928 feet elevation forms a massive backdrop for Union Pacific’s LUL57 local at Juab siding, Utah. The local is known as the Lynndyl Local and runs south on the Sharp Sub from Provo yard about 80 miles to a junction with the Lynndyl Sub at Lynndyl, Utah. It returns back north to Provo the next day. There are two major traffic sources on the sub; the coal loadout at Sharp and the cement plant at Leamington. Several other businesses provide less traffic. Mount Nebo is the highest and southernmost peak in the Wasatch Range. |
